Stadium
is a football stadium in , , Russia built for the 2018 FIFA World Cup. It hosted FC Mordovia Saransk, prior to their dissolution in 2020 from the Russian Professional Football League, replacing . is situated 3 km northwest of Michurino.

Village
is a village in the , , located within the administrative borders of the Republic's capital . Famous Russian Orthodox elder and wonder worker Sampson Sievers was a parish priest in this village during Soviet time.
